Jane (Sarah Bowman) leaves work late one night expecting to drive home when she is pulled into an unusual world. While traveling across various locations and interacting with Terrance (Dorian Hurst) and Amanda (McKenzie McLeod), Jane realizes she is out of time and can no longer return home.
